Key elements of the OSHA equipment inspection form template

Our form encompasses crucial components to ensure thorough evaluations:

  • General information: Record essential details such as the facility name, inspection date, and inspector’s name. This foundational information ensures accurate documentation and helps track inspection history, making it easier to monitor compliance and identify recurring issues.
  • Safety features: Verify that all safety guards are in place and functioning properly. Ensure emergency stop buttons are accessible and operational, and that warning labels and placards are legible and in good condition throughout your equipment.
  • Operational integrity: Inspect the equipment for any obvious damage or defects. Ensure that all electrical connections are secure and in good condition, and properly ground the equipment to prevent electrical hazards.
  • Mechanical components: Ensure all moving parts are properly guarded and functioning smoothly by assessing them. Verify that fluid levels are within the proper range and that the equipment is free of any fluid leaks, which could indicate maintenance issues.
  • Safety devices: Confirm that all safety devices, such as limit switches, are functioning properly. These devices are critical for preventing accidents and ensuring the safe operation of your equipment.
  • Documentation and follow-up: Maintain comprehensive records of inspections and any corrective actions taken. Additionally, this ensures transparency and supports continuous improvement in equipment safety practices, providing a clear history of efforts and facilitating future planning.

Each section guides your team through essential inspection tasks, ensuring nothing is overlooked. Additionally, this comprehensive approach enhances equipment safety management, promoting security and compliance within your organization.

Frequently asked questions

How can your organization ensure thorough OSHA equipment inspections?

To ensure thorough OSHA equipment inspections, your organization should establish a routine schedule and assign trained personnel to conduct inspections. Use detailed checklists aligned with OSHA standards to guide the process. Encourage your team to document findings meticulously and report any issues immediately. Additionally, regularly review inspection protocols and update them as needed to incorporate new regulations or equipment changes, ensuring comprehensive compliance.

What common challenges might your team face during equipment inspections?

Your team might encounter challenges such as incomplete documentation, lack of training, or outdated equipment. To address these, provide regular training sessions to enhance inspection skills and update knowledge on OSHA standards. Ensure your team has access to the latest inspection tools and resources. Additionally, encourage open communication to quickly resolve any issues and maintain a high standard of safety and compliance within your organization.

How can you address equipment inspection failures effectively?

When inspection failures occur, prompt action is crucial. First, investigate the root cause and involve your team in developing corrective measures. Document the failure and corrective actions taken, ensuring transparency and accountability. Implement additional training if needed to prevent recurrence. Additionally, regularly review inspection outcomes to identify patterns or recurring issues, enabling your organization to proactively address potential risks and improve overall safety compliance.
